Description

To carry out the maintenance of the Council's esixting plants at the Council Offices, Holt Road, Cromer Norfolk NR27 9EN, to include watering, feeding, removal of dead leaves and debris, replacement of dead plants, cleabing of leaves, organic bio pest control, pruning and staking.
